This is an automated email from the ASF dual-hosted git repository.
lidavidm p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/arrow.git.
from acc6c2e ARROW-15968: [C++] Update AsyncGenerator semantics to emit a
terminal item only after all outstanding futures have completed
add c2fac05 ARROW-15314: [C++][Java][FlightRPC] Add missing metadata on
Arrow schemas returned by Flight SQL
No new revisions were added by this update.
Summary of changes:
.../flight/integration_tests/test_integration.cc | 16 +-
cpp/src/arrow/flight/sql/CMakeLists.txt | 8 +-
cpp/src/arrow/flight/sql/column_metadata.cc | 177 ++++++++++++
cpp/src/arrow/flight/sql/column_metadata.h | 169 ++++++++++++
cpp/src/arrow/flight/sql/example/sqlite_server.cc | 21 ++
cpp/src/arrow/flight/sql/example/sqlite_server.h | 5 +
.../arrow/flight/sql/example/sqlite_statement.cc | 34 ++-
.../arrow/flight/sql/example/sqlite_statement.h | 8 +
.../example/sqlite_tables_schema_batch_reader.cc | 8 +-
cpp/src/arrow/flight/sql/server_test.cc | 37 ++-
format/FlightSql.proto | 39 ++-
.../tests/FlightSqlScenarioProducer.java | 12 +-
.../arrow/flight/sql/FlightSqlColumnMetadata.java | 296 +++++++++++++++++++++
.../org/apache/arrow/flight/TestFlightSql.java | 71 ++++-
.../arrow/flight/sql/example/FlightSqlExample.java | 21 +-
15 files changed, 897 insertions(+), 25 deletions(-)
create mode 100644 cpp/src/arrow/flight/sql/column_metadata.cc
create mode 100644 cpp/src/arrow/flight/sql/column_metadata.h
create mode 100644
java/flight/flight-sql/src/main/java/org/apache/arrow/flight/sql/FlightSqlColumnMetadata.java